Output 9398de4bc64e6da6e1ad6e80ec09be7ef3d5ef97890893a0b4ee23019b7fad10:1

value
26116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2649a9f11afc8016c0516b4bf33fe4735387d42 OP_EQUAL
address
3NL59z6PdLZube63TtJS75HVkRaFc7DML7
transaction
9398de4bc64e6da6e1ad6e80ec09be7ef3d5ef97890893a0b4ee23019b7fad10
confirmations
300370
spent
true